How to build an RV door?

To build an RV door, you will need to follow the steps described below.

  • Take the measurements of the RV door
  • Decide on the type of door
  • Build the frame
  • Build the RV door
  • Add the hinges
  • Install the bolts
  • Install the RV door
  • Add door seal
  • Paint the door.

Take the measurements of the RV door

  • To build an RV door, you need to know the right measurements first. Measure the area where you need to install the RV door. This is a simple process, but the measurements need to be accurate.
  • Make sure to measure the length and the width accurately with a measuring tape. Don’t forget to note down the measurements that you have taken.

Decide on the type of door

  • Next, you will need to decide on the type of RV door that you want to build. There are several types of RV doors including fiberglass, wood, and aluminum.  This also depends on the type of RV that you have.
  • Building an aluminum door will require more work but there are several benefits and working with fiberglass is not easy. However, a wooden RV door is easy to work with and it also provides a great finish and appearance to your RV. Wooden RV doors are also versatile and can be installed on any type of RV. 
  • There is no need for welding and you can easily build a wooden RV door at a minimal cost. You will also need minimal equipment and material to complete this project.

Build the frame

  • The most important part is to construct a sturdy RV frame to hold the door. For this, you will need to use wood that is strong and broad enough. 2 by 4s is one of the safest options for this project as it consumes less space and they are easy to work. However, 2 by 4s are recommended only if you use plywood or wooden panels for the RV door.
  • Based on the length of the RV door, you will need to cut two 2 by 4s. Next, you will need to cut the same for the width. Note that the size of the width will be a little smaller than the usual measurements. 
  • To get accurate measurements you will need to place the vertical beams on either side of the RV entrance and measure the horizontal space for the width. In simpler terms, the frame should be fixed exactly to the measurements of the door.
  • Make sure to smoothen the frame a little to ensure that there are no rough surfaces.
  • Secure the door frame to the RV wall. Make sure that the surface makes contact properly. You can use screws to secure the RV door frame to the RV wall.

Build the RV door

  • The next step is to build the RV door. Use a single piece of plywood for the door. You can use plywood that is up to four inches thick. The only tough part is cutting the plywood to the right side.
  • Use a measuring tape and measure the vacant space inside the frame. Ensure that the measurements are accurate. Cut the plywood into a single door panel and double-check the measurements once again by holding the panel against the RV door opening. Make adjustments if they are necessary.
  • Use a sander and make the surface of the plywood smooth. Remove all rough spots before the installation.

Add the hinges

  • Next, you will need to add hinges to the plywood door. Use piano hinges since they are long and strong enough to hold the door to the frame.
  • Install the hinges on the door first and make sure that they are installed straight. You can add up to four hinges from top to bottom.

Install the bolts

  • In the next step, you will be required to install the bolts. Fix a lock outside the RV door and a bolt on the inside to keep it shut. You can install a lock according to your preference.
  • Be sure to install a couple of bolts on the inside. Use screws instead of nails since they will hold better. The door’s edge should be secured to the frame with a bolt and latch. You will be required to install the provision for the latch on the inside of the door frame as well.

Install the RV door

  • It’s time to install the RV door to the RV frame. Mark the area where you need to install the hinges. Hold the door straight while marking. You might need an extra set of hands for this process. While installing the RV door, drill the screws properly and straight.
  • Check if the door is opening and closing properly. The door must be fixed to the door frame without any gap.

Add door seal

  • The RV door is a critical part and it must be built properly at any cost. You will be required to seal the door from the inside and the outside. Add molding around the inside of the door opening and place the seal on the molding facing out.
  • This will help the door to flush against the frame. You can also add molding outside on the door and place the seal of the molding facing in.

Paint the door

  • Now that you are done with the installation, it’s time to go ahead and give your new RV door a good painting job. You can add a couple of layers of paint and make sure that the RV door is matched the walls of the RV.
